How to persist data after deployment in Solidity


I am pretty new to Solidity and working with Ethereum in general. In the (d)app I'm working on I need to be able to persist data onto the ledger, but I'm not sure I understand how this works.

Let's say I have the following contract (simplified for practicality):

Using the insertUser() method, I can insert a new user, and using a getter method I could retrieve the user's information.

Now, if I update the contract (thus deploy a new one), the users mapping is empty again, not surprising.

My question: how do I store data in a way that it will be accessible for future versions of the contract? Any design patterns that go along with this process?

Solution

  • Since, as you know, stored data will not travel with a new contract and copying over data to a new contract would be expensive task after a few uses...your best bet is to separate functionality from data storage.

    Create a contract with some basic setters and getters that only deals with data storage (from a particular contract address if necessary)...then create your main functional contract that connects to the data contract.
